The City of St. Augustine is opening applications for the Residential Composting Program beginning Monday, July 14, until quantity limits are met. Through the City’s Residential Composting Program, residents in single family homes within City limits are invited to apply for a backyard compost bin free of charge.
Residents are encouraged to contribute food and yard waste to their compost bins to create nutrient-rich compost that can be used in their own garden. Collection service is not offered as part of this program.
Complete information about the program, including eligibility criteria and the application form, is available on the City’s website www.citystaug.com/compost;
